Do you offer any specific grooming services for the dense undercoat common in breeds like Siberian Huskies or Malamutes, especially before the damp, cooler seasons on South Whidbey?

Yes, we specialize in de-shedding treatments that are essential for double-coated breeds in our climate. Our service includes a high-velocity blow-out and specialized brushing techniques to thoroughly remove the loose undercoat before the fall and winter rains set in. This helps regulate your pet's body temperature, prevents matting from the damp air, and significantly reduces shedding in your home.

Now, let’s talk about the ‘spa’ part. Our South Whidbey environment, as beautiful as it is, can be tough on a coat. Sandy paws, salty ocean spray, and those ever-present burrs from our hikes are a constant battle. A professional grooming session at a spa is the perfect reset. It’s not just a bath; it’s a deep-clean with deshedding treatments, a precise haircut, nail grinding, and ear cleaning. This isn’t just about looking good—it’s about preventing mats, checking for hidden ticks or skin issues, and ensuring your dog is comfortable and healthy.

For Freeland pet owners considering a local dog resort and spa, here’s some practical advice. First, schedule a tour. Any reputable facility will welcome you to see the play areas, sleeping quarters, and meet the staff. Ask about their routine, their staff-to-dog ratio, and their protocol for emergencies. Mention your dog’s specific needs—perhaps they’re shy, or have endless energy from our beach runs. A good resort will tailor the experience.
